What Are AI Agents in DeFi?

AI agents are autonomous systems powered by artificial intelligence that can make decisions, execute tasks, and adapt to changing environments without constant human intervention. When integrated into DeFi platforms, these agents leverage data-driven algorithms and machine learning techniques to perform tasks like trading, lending, risk assessment, and market analysis.

Key Features of AI Agents in DeFi:

Autonomy: Operate independently based on pre-programmed algorithms.
Data-Driven Decisions: Analyze real-time data to make informed choices.
Adaptability: Continuously improve through machine learning.
Transparency: Operate within the decentralized, immutable framework of blockchain technology.

By combining these features, AI agents enhance the capabilities of DeFi platforms, making them more efficient and user-friendly.

The Role of AI Agents in DeFi

The integration of AI agents in DeFi spans various applications, each contributing to financial automation and optimization.

1. Automated Trading and Market Making

AI agents excel in executing trades and providing liquidity in DeFi markets. Unlike traditional bots, AI-powered agents analyze vast amounts of data, such as market trends, price fluctuations, and on-chain activity, to make smarter trading decisions.

Example:

  1. AI agents can participate in automated market-making (AMM) protocols like Uniswap or Balancer, optimizing liquidity pools for maximum profitability.
  2. They also help execute arbitrage trades across multiple DeFi platforms, exploiting price differences efficiently.

2. Smart Lending and Borrowing

AI agents enhance lending and borrowing protocols by evaluating creditworthiness, managing risk, and optimizing loan terms.

Key Benefits:

Credit Scoring: AI agents analyze on-chain data to assess the risk profile of borrowers.
Dynamic Interest Rates: They help adjust rates based on market conditions and borrower behavior.
Loan Management: AI agents can monitor loans and trigger automated liquidation processes when collateral thresholds are breached.

3. Risk Management and Fraud Detection

DeFi platforms are prone to risks such as smart contract vulnerabilities, market manipulation, and flash loan attacks. AI agents mitigate these risks by identifying patterns and anomalies in real-time.

Applications in Risk Management:

Fraud Detection: AI algorithms detect suspicious activities, such as abnormal transaction patterns.
Portfolio Monitoring: AI agents provide users with risk assessments and portfolio diversification recommendations.
Smart Contract Audits: AI-powered tools can automatically audit DeFi protocols for vulnerabilities.

4. Yield Optimization

One of the most prominent uses of AI agents in DeFi is yield farming, where users maximize their returns by moving funds across different protocols.

AI-Powered Yield Farming:

  1. AI agents evaluate various DeFi protocols to identify the highest-yield opportunities.
  2. They automate the process of staking, harvesting, and reinvesting rewards, saving time and effort for users.

5. Decentralized Governance

In dec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s), AI agents play a critical role by analyzing governance proposals and providing insights for informed decision-making.

Examples of Governance Automation:

  1. Voting recommendations based on user preferences.
  2. Predictive analytics to assess the impact of governance proposals.
  3. Real-time updates on the status of governance votes.

Challenges of Implementing AI Agents in DeFi

Despite the significant potential, several challenges need to be addressed:

Data Privacy: AI agents require large datasets, raising concerns about user privacy.
Complexity: Integrating AI into DeFi protocols requires advanced technical expertise.
Regulation: The decentralized nature of DeFi complicates compliance with global financial regulations.
Bias in Algorithms: AI models can inherit biases from training data, leading to unfair decisions.
Energy Consumption: Training and deploying AI models require significant computational resources, raising sustainability concerns.
Addressing these challenges is critical for the widespread adoption of AI agents in DeFi.

Real-World Use Cases of AI Agents in DeFi

Several projects are already leveraging AI to enhance DeFi:

SingularityDAO: Uses AI for portfolio management and dynamic asset allocation.
Fetch.ai: Provides AI-powered solutions for optimizing DeFi trading and resource allocation.
Cortex: Integrates AI models into smart contracts for advanced decision-making.
Numerai: A hedge fund that uses AI and crowdsourced predictions to improve DeFi strategies.

These examples highlight the transformative potential of AI agents in decentralized finance.
